One key aspect of safe vaping practices is the charging current, and it’s recommended to charge your vape at no more than 2A. In this article, we will explore why adhering to this guideline is essential.
Firstly, charging your vape device at more than 2A can lead to overheating. Lithium-ion batteries, commonly used in vaping devices, are sensitive to excessive currents. When charged too quickly, they generate heat, which can cause damage to the battery cells. In extreme cases, this heat can result in battery failure or even fires. By keeping the charging rate at 2A or below, you minimize the risk of overheating, thereby ensuring the safety of both the device and the user.
Secondly, charging at lower currents prolongs the lifespan of your vape’s battery. Batteries have a finite number of charge cycles, and high charging rates can accelerate wear and tear. By opting for a 2A charge limit, you allow the battery to charge more efficiently and maintain its chemical integrity. This means your vape device will not only last longer but will also perform better over time. It is also important to consider the quality of the charging equipment being used. Using subpar chargers can exacerbate the issues related to high charging rates. Always opt for high-quality chargers that are specifically designed for your vape device. Look for chargers that have built-in safety features such as over-current protection and temperature monitoring. This way, you are taking an extra step to ensure the safety and longevity of your vape device.
